HTML5表单与图像:轻松创建丰富交互式网页
HTML5 表单与图像:轻松创建丰富交互式网页
HTML5 是一种被广泛应用于网页开发中的标记语言,它为网页开发者提供了一系列新鲜且强大的功能。今天,我们将重点探讨 HTML5 表单和图像元素在网页设计中的作用。通过合理运用这些功能,我们可以创建出更加丰富、交互性强的网页。
一、HTML5 表单元素
在 HTML5 中,表单元素被分为两种:`
“`
在上述示例中,我们创建了一个名为 “myForm” 的表单,并添加了两个输入框和一个按钮。用户在填写表单后,点击“登录”按钮,表单数据将被提交。
2. 文件上传表单元素
`
“`
用户在上述示例中,可以点击“上传”按钮选择一个文件,然后数据将被上传到服务器。
3. 富文本表单元素
`
“`
用户在上述示例中,可以在“内容”文本框中输入各种类型的文本内容,然后点击“发布”按钮将其发布到服务器。
4. 数组表单元素
如果需要创建一个数组表单,可以使用 `
“`
在上述示例中,我们创建了一个名为 “arrayForm” 的表单,并添加了两个输入框。用户可以在输入框中分别输入多个用户名和年龄,然后点击“添加”按钮将数据添加到数组中。
二、HTML5 图像元素
除了表单元素,HTML5 还提供了 `` 标签用于在网页中插入图像。
1. 普通图片元素
`` 标签可以用于在网页中插入一张图片,用户可以直接在浏览器中查看图片。
例如:
“`html
“`
在上述示例中,我们使用 `` 标签在网页中插入了一张名为 “example.jpg” 的图片,并设置了一个简单的替代文本。
2. 动态图像元素
`` 标签也可以在网页中创建一个动态的图像元素,这个元素会根据不同的 CSS 样式显示不同的部分。
例如:
“`html
“`
在上述示例中,我们使用 `` 标签在网页中创建了一个宽度为 50%,高度为 50% 的动态图像元素。这个元素会根据宽度 和高度的比例来显示图片的不同部分。
3. 缩放缩放图片元素
`` 标签还支持创建一个可以缩放的图片元素,使得用户可以放大或缩小图片。
例如:
“`html
“`
在上述示例中,我们使用 `` 标签在网页中创建了一个可以缩放的图片元素。这个元素的宽度为 100%,高度为 100%,这意味着它将整个图片显示出来。
4. 响应式图像元素
在移动设备上,`` 标签也可以使用 `min-width: 320px` 和 `max-width: 800px` 响应式属性来创建一个响应式的图像元素。
例如:
“`html
“`
在上述示例中,我们使用 `` 标签在移动设备上创建了一个响应式的图片元素。这个元素的宽度在 320 像素时显示图片的全部内容,在 800 像素时只显示图片的部分内容。
结合以上功能,我们可以创建出各种不同类型的交互式网页,使得用户体验更加丰富。当然,开发者还可以结合其他前端技术,如 JavaScript、CSS、JavaScript 等,来进一步扩展 HTML5 表单和图像元素的功能。